Privacy Policy

Effective Date: July 1, 2025
Last Updated: July 1, 2025

Modern Septic Service (“Modern Septic,” “we,” “our,” or “us”) values your trust and respects your privacy. This Privacy Policy explains how we collect, use, share, and protect your personal information when you visit our website at www.modernsepticservice.com (the “Site”) or use our septic and wastewater management services (the “Services”).

When you use our Services, you’re trusting us with your information. We understand this is a big responsibility and work hard to protect your information and put you in control.

1. Our Commitment to Privacy

Your privacy matters to us. We are committed to protecting your personal information through transparency, security, and lawful data handling.

Modern Septic complies with all applicable California privacy laws, including:

  • California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A/CPRA)

  • California Online Privacy Protection Act (CalOPPA)

  • Children’s Online Privacy Protection Act (COPPA)

We will never sell, rent, or trade your data. All personal information is collected for legitimate business purposes only—to serve you, maintain operations, and comply with the law.

2. What Information We Collect

We collect personal and non-personal information necessary to provide our Services and ensure safety and compliance, including:

  • Personal Identifiers: Name, mailing address, service address, email, and phone number

  • Service & Job Data: Appointment requests, service records, property details, photographs, and inspection reports.

  • Payment Information: Billing details, transaction identifiers, and payment method data (processed securely through PCI-compliant vendors).

  • Communication Records: Calls, emails, texts (SMS), and other correspondence.

  • Device & Technical Data: IP address, browser type, operating system, device ID, and usage patterns.

  • Cookies & Analytics Data: Information gathered through cookies and tracking technologies.

  • Geolocation (Approximate): Used for dispatch and routing efficiency when scheduling service.

3. How We Collect Information

We collect data through several lawful and transparent means:

  • Directly from you: When you complete forms, schedule service, or communicate by phone, email, or SMS.

  • Automatically: Via cookies, analytics tools, and website logs that track page visits and device type.

  • From trusted third parties: Such as payment processors, mapping/routing tools, or financing partners, solely to deliver Services.

  • Support interactions: When you engage with customer service, warranty, or technical assistance.

4. Why We Collect Information

We use your data for legitimate, transparent business purposes, including to:

  • Deliver, schedule, and complete septic services and repairs.

  • Process payments, send invoices, and manage financing requests.

  • Communicate updates, confirmations, or service-related notices.

  • Maintain customer records, job history, and warranty documentation.

  • Ensure safety, prevent fraud, and comply with legal requirements.

  • Improve service quality, website performance, and customer experience.

  • Provide customer support and resolve disputes.

5. How We Protect Your Data

We implement administrative, technical, and physical safeguards to protect your data from unauthorized access, alteration, or disclosure, including:

  • Encrypted transmission (HTTPS/TLS) and encrypted data storage where applicable.

  • PCI-compliant payment processing by certified vendors.

  • Access control & least-privilege practices—only authorized staff can view sensitive data.

  • Confidentiality agreements for all employees and contractors.

  • Routine security audits and system monitoring to detect intrusion or misuse.

  • Secure data disposal when information is no longer required.

While no system can be guaranteed 100% secure, we maintain robust defenses consistent with or exceeding California data-security requirements (Cal. Civ. Code §1798.81.5).

6. Who We Share Information With

We share limited data only with trusted service partners who assist in business operations and are bound by strict confidentiality agreements:

  • Payment Processors: To securely handle transactions.

  • Scheduling & Dispatch Partners: For routing and technician assignments.

  • Analytics Providers: To measure and improve website performance.

  • Legal or Regulatory Agencies: Only when required by law, subpoena, or to protect safety and rights.

We do not sell, rent, or trade your personal data to third parties for marketing purposes.

Mobile Opt-In, SMS consent, and phone numbers collected for SMS communication purposes will not be shared with third parties and affiliates for marketing purposes.

7. Your Rights & Choices (California Consumer Rights)

If you are a California resident, you have the following rights under the CCPA/CPRA:

  1. Right to Know: What data we collect, its sources, and purposes.

  2. Right to Access: Obtain a copy of your personal data.

  3. Right to Correct: Fix inaccurate or outdated information.

  4. Right to Delete: Request deletion of personal data (subject to legal retention duties).

  5. Right to Opt-Out: Of any data “sale” or “sharing” (we do not currently sell or share data).

  6. Right to Non-Discrimination: You will not face reduced service or pricing for exercising your rights.

To exercise your rights, contact us by email or phone: info@modernsepticservice.com | (619) 444-1131 We verify all requests to protect against unauthorized access.

8. Do Not Sell or Share My Personal Information

Modern Septic Service does not “sell” or “share” personal information as defined under the California Privacy Rights Act (CPRA). If our practices change, we will update this Policy and provide an online mechanism allowing customers to opt out.

9. Children’s Privacy

Our website and Services are intended for adults and businesses. We do not knowingly collect personal data from children under 13 years of age. If you believe a minor has provided information to us, please contact us immediately at info@modernsepticservice.com so we can delete it.

10. Data Retention

We retain information only as long as necessary to fulfill service, legal, or warranty obligations. For example:

  • Service and compliance records are retained per regulatory requirements.

  • Payment and tax records may be stored for up to seven years as required by law.

  • Once no longer needed, information is securely deleted or anonymized.

11. Cookies & Tracking

We use cookies and similar tools for site functionality, analytics, and performance improvement. You may opt out of non-essential cookies through your browser settings. If required by law, consent banners will appear for new visitors.

12. Policy Updates

We may periodically update this Privacy Policy to reflect legal, operational, or technological changes. If changes are significant, we will post a clear notice on our website or contact customers directly. The “Effective Date” at the top of this Policy reflects the latest revision.
